One simple option I can think off, is gathering the statistics from "Channel Status".   Channel status will give you the number of messages and number of bytes transmitted. 
 
In absence of monitoring tools, I suggest to run a query every night to take a snap shot of channel status and analyse the figures from there (either through a script or program).  I do know that channel sequence number gets reset after reaching it's maximum defined on the channel definition and you have to factor this in counting the messages.  However, I am not sure how big are the other fields and when do they get reset - you have to give a go at them and see (unless somebody add some info from this forum). The fields of interest are:
 
        LSTSEQNO, BYTSSENT, BYTSRCVD, BUFSSENT, BUFSRCVD (and of course buffer size if you need).

My client has requested that I give them statistics on MQSeries messages ( volumes etc) on a monthly basis. There is no MQ monitoring / admin software installed other than the standard MQ.

We have a hub and spoke architecture, and all mq messages currently flow through the central windows 2000 server and use circular logging. No clustering or MQclients are involved at this stage. On the hub we have WMQI flows for message transformation and distribution purposes.

I would like to find out what the most optimal way would be to gather statistics on message volumes passing through our central HUB server. The 2 options I am considering at the moment is to either use channel exits or to actually modify the message flows to add another destination for each message flow. This additional queue will trigger a program which will collect stats for monthly reporting.

Any advice will be much appreciated!

(WMQI version 2.1 and WMQ version 5.3)
